Margin is a way of positioning elements relative to their current position on the page. It is best used when you just need to add some space between two elements. There are other use-cases for it too, but this is what I find myself using it for most often.

You can add margin to the top, bottom, left, and right of elements. And there are a couple different styles you can use to write this. These are referred to as shorthand syntax.

//10px margin on all sides
margin: 10px;

//10px margin top and bottom, 20px margin left and right
margin: 10px 20px;

//Set margin for each side specifically. 
//Order: top, right, bottom, left
margin: 1px 2px 3px 4px;

//each side has a specific property too.
margin-top: 5px;
margin-left: 5px;
margin-right: 5px;
margin-bottom: 5px;


